#291370 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#291370 is composed of 16.1% red, 7.5%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 83%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 254.2 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 25.7%. #291370 color hex could be obtained by blending #5226e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#291370 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#291370 has RGB values of R:41, G:19,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2691952.

Shades and Tints of #291370
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020b is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#291370
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414043 is the less saturated color, while #21047f is the most saturated one.
